Hey All,

I'm looking to write a Macro in Outlook 2003 that will flag messages
red when they are 29 days old.

I would also like to set something up that will delete messages that
have a certain color flag when I hit a custom button.

Has anyone done antyhing like this before? I'm pretty familiar with
Excel VBA, but this is my first attempt in Outlook.

Thanks for any help!!

How about a search folder for messages older than 29 days? you could also
use one for the color delete one - then select all and delete the messages
in it. This is safer than using na automated system and doesn't require
hours of programming.
